Pakistan - Turnips and Carrots Producer Price Index

Since 2011, Pakistan Turnips and Carrots Producer Price Index rose 4.7% year on year. In 2016, the country was number 33 comparing other countries in Turnips and Carrots Producer Price Index with 197.8 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100. Pakistan is overtaken by Kazakhstan, which was number 32 at 198.89 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 and is followed by Ecuador with 194.54 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100. Venezuela ranked the highest with 48,908.1 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 in 2016, that is +659% compared to 2015. Argentina, Belarus and Azerbaijan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Venezuela recorded the best 5 years average growth at +135.7% per year, while Netherlands witnessed the worst performance at -11.4% per year.
